It may or may not come as a surprise that videos are 6 x more likely to be retweeted than photos and 3 x more likely than GIFs. Perhaps this summer in particular has favoured itself to the use of videos, covering major sporting events; including the World Cup. Video can be used to cover any topic from the entertaining to the hard-hitting, to effectively portray a story.For example, the narrow, confined dark spaces that recently faced the Thai rescue mission. Moments like these are viewed 5x more than through other sources and create an 80% increase in memory encoding. Encoding refers to the crucial first step in creating a new memory, this is the beginning of perception through the senses.
